Japan captain Wataru Endo withdraws from 2026 World Cup due to injury

Japan captain Wataru Endo has withdrawn from the 2026 World Cup squad due to injury, significantly impacting Japan's midfield stability and forcing tactical adjustments. This absence weakens Japan's competitive position and may influence market assessments of the team's tournament prospects.
